Is 727489 a prime number?
It is possible to find out using mathematical methods whether a given integer is a prime number or not.
No, 727 489 is not a prime number.
For example, 727 489 can be divided by 7: 727 489 / 7 = 103 927.
For 727 489 to be a prime number, it would have been required that 727 489 has only two divisors, i.e., itself and 1.
